The main reasons for the fluctuation of Bitcoin price can be attributed to the following points:
1. Market supply and demand relationship: The supply of Bitcoin is limited, with a total limit of 21 million coins, and this scarcity has to some extent driven its price up. The fluctuations on the demand side, such as investors’ buying or selling, also directly affect the price.
2. Market sentiment: The fluctuation of Bitcoin price is often influenced by market sentiment. For example, reports from mainstream media, hype on social networks, and comments from well-known investors can all trigger emotional fluctuations among investors, leading to severe market volatility.
3. Uncertainty of Regulatory Policies: As a decentralized digital currency, the market performance of Bitcoin is often affected by changes in regulatory policies in various countries around the world. Governments of different countries have different attitudes towards Bitcoin. Strengthening regulation in some countries may lead to price declines, while loose policies or supportive attitudes may promote price increases.
4. * * Technological updates and network issues * *: As a technological infrastructure, Bitcoin’s price is also affected by factors such as technological updates and network congestion. For example, an upgrade or hard fork event in the Bitcoin network may cause panic or optimism among investors, thereby affecting market prices.

In highly volatile markets, stop loss and take profit are effective means of protecting one’s investments. Investors can set reasonable stop loss and take profit levels based on their investment goals and risk tolerance, thereby avoiding significant losses caused by market volatility.
1. * * Stop loss * *: Stop loss refers to the automatic sale of Bitcoin by investors when the price drops to a predetermined level, thereby reducing losses. The setting of stop loss points should be determined based on the overall market trend, individual investment strategies, and risk preferences.
2. * * Take profit * *: Take profit refers to when investors choose to sell Bitcoin to achieve profits when the price rises to a certain level. A reasonable take profit point can help investors make timely profits at market highs and avoid missing the best selling opportunity due to excessive greed.
